| 9:14:33 A.M. |
H. Res. 470 |
Considered as privileged matter. H. Res. 470 — "Provid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 3094) to amend the National Labor Relations Act with respect to representation hearings and the timing of elections of labor organizations under that Act."
|
| 9:17:43 A.M. |
H. Res. 470 |
DEBATE - The House proceeded with one hour of debate on H. Res. 470.
|
| 10:02:51 A.M. |
H. Res. 470 |
The previous question was ordered without objection.
|
| 10:03:03 A.M. |
H. Res. 470 |
POSTPONED PROCEEDINGS - At the conclusion of debate on H. Res. 470, the Chair put the question on adoption of the resolution and by voice vote, announced that the ayes had prevailed. Mr. Polis demanded the yeas and nays and the Chair postponed further proceedings on the question of adoption of the resolution until a time to be announced.

| 10:08:03 A.M. |
H.J. Res. 2 |
Considered as unfinished business. H.J. Res. 2 — "Proposing a balanced budget amendment to the Constitution of the United States."
|
| 10:08:20 A.M. |
H.J. Res. 2 |
DEBATE - The House resumed debate on H.J. Res. 2. When proceedings were postponed on Thursday, November 17, 2011, 2 hours and 42 minutes of debate remained.
|
| 1:57:23 P.M. |
H.J. Res. 2 |
On motion to suspend the rules and pass the resolution, as amended Failed by the Yeas and Nays: (2/3 required): 261 - 165 (Roll no. 858).
